What is the financial outlay associated with traveling from Salford to Havering by car?

The journey, powered by petrol, incurs a cost of £38.4. In this computational scenario, the price of petrol is assumed to be 144 pence per liter, and the car's fuel efficiency stands at 37.5 miles per gallon.

For individuals contemplating carpooling arrangements, the expenditure per traveler diminishes as the number of passengers increases. With two passengers, the cost per person amounts to £19.2 (£38.4/2). For a trio of passengers, the cost per person reduces to £12.8 (£38.4/3), and for a quartet of passengers, it further decreases to £9.6 (£38.4/4).

To provide further elucidation on the calculation process, let us dissect how the final figure is derived:

Initially, the requisite fuel quantity is determined by dividing the distance traveled by the car's fuel consumption rate. For a journey spanning 219.82 miles, this computation entails multiplying 219.82 miles by 4.54609 (liters per gallon) and subsequently dividing by the car's fuel efficiency of 37.5 mpg, resulting in a requirement of 26.6 liters of fuel.

Subsequently, the fuel expenditure is computed by multiplying the amount of fuel required by the price per liter. Given a consumption of 26.6 liters of fuel at a rate of 144 pence per liter, the cumulative cost equals £38.4.

In summation, the total fuel expenditure for the trip from Salford to Havering stands at £38.4.
